Jaxlynn is a unique and intriguing name of unknown origin. It does not appear to have a direct translation or meaning in any specific language. Some people speculate that it may be a blend of two names, such as Jacqueline and Lynn, but there is no concrete evidence to support this theory.
Despite its mysterious origins, Jaxlynn has gained some popularity in recent years. According to data from the Social Security Administration, the name first appeared on the list of popular baby names in the United States in 2007, with only five girls being given the name that year. Since then, its usage has fluctuated, peaking at 145 instances in 2016 before declining again.
One possible reason for Jaxlynn's rise in popularity may be its similarity to other trendy names of the time, such as Jasmine and Jacqueline. Its unique spelling and sound also make it stand out from more traditional names, which could appeal to parents looking for something distinctive for their child.
